We have made the difficult decision to cancel this year’s ICT in Education Conference, which was scheduled to take place on Friday 17th and Saturday 18th October.
Unfortunately, the number of registered attendees is too low to allow us to deliver the kind of meaningful and engaging event that participants have come to expect. Given this, we believe the best decision is to cancel the conference for now.
The environment in which we operate has changed significantly over the more than 20 years that we have been running this event. Teacher Professional Development has evolved considerably, and the widespread shift to online and hybrid learning, accelerated by Covid, has inevitably affected in-person events like ours. Likewise, Technology-Enhanced Teaching and Learning and Computer Science education in Ireland have transformed over the years.  These changes have left us in a bit of a quandary on how to progress, so, for now we take a step back and consider how best to proceed.   
As a final thought: events like ours, which bring together teachers from across the broad spectrum of education in Ireland, play an important role. They provide opportunities to learn with and from each other, and are key to creating supportive, engaging learning environments for our students.  As a team we would like to come back with a more relevant offering if that is of interest to educators, and to that end we will be in touch in the coming weeks to explore what that might look like.  n the meantime please feel free to contact me at pamela...@tus.ie if you have any thoughts or suggestions.
